So-called "miners" run purpose-built computers which compete to solve complex math puzzles in order to make a transaction go through. Bitcoin isn't controlled by any single authority — like a central bank — but a disparate network of computers. Many investors today consider bitcoin to be a form of "digital gold" rather than an efficient payment system — Digiconomist estimates that the energy footprint of one bitcoin transaction is equivalent to 453,000 payments on the Visa network. Bitcoin's price surge has caused a run on bitcoin mining computers, with Bitmain, a major maker of so-called mining rigs, sold out through August, while competitor Canaan is working through a backlog of 100,000 orders. A key incentive of bitcoin's model, known as "proof of work," is the promise of being rewarded in some bitcoin if you manage to solve the complex hashing algorithm. While there are only about 1 million bitcoin miners in the world, according to an industry estimate, the amount of electricity that mining consumes in one year is equal to that used to power Malaysia, Sweden or Ukraine, according to the Cambridge Bitcoin Electricity Consumption Index. © 2021 CNBC LLC. The cryptocurrency consumes more electricity than the entire annual energy consumption of the Netherlands, Cambridge University researchers say. / MoneyWatch. The blockchain — a digital ledger of all bitcoin transactions — is designed this way to ensure that users aren't able to "double spend" funds, a flaw in which the same digital token could be spent more than once. The Cambridge Bitcoin Electricity Consumption Index, a separate tool from researchers at Cambridge University, shows a much larger figure of 110.53 TWh — more than the entire annual energy consumption of the Netherlands. The research was published in Joule magazine by cryptocurrency economist Alex De Vries, who noted that bitcoin's energy use this year will rival that of all cloud-computing data centers globally. That sort of comparison, however, may be driving bitcoin into a speculative frenzy that could "lock in" high emissions for years to come. According to research released this week, bitcoin's record-high prices have created a crypto mining backlog such that, even if the price falls, emissions from mining the virtual currency are likely to stay high for the near future. The process of mining a bitcoin involves multitudes of computers competing to solve a complex math problem, in which the first to reach a solution is rewarded with a bitcoin.
